Leslie Dach joins Wal-Mart as Executive Vice President of Corporate Affairs and Government Relations

BENTONVILLE, Ark., July 24, 2006 --Wal-Mart Stores, Inc. today announced that Leslie Dach, 52, will join the company as Executive Vice President of Corporate Affairs and Government Relations, effective late August.  He will report to President and Chief Executive Officer Lee Scott, and will serve as a member of the company’s Executive Committee.
 
Dach’s responsibilities will include oversight of the company’s communications and government relations, as well as the Wal-Mart Foundation, the largest corporate foundation in the U.S.
 
Reflecting on the changes that Wal-Mart has undertaken, Lee Scott said of Dach’s appointment, "Leslie has been a part of our transformation over the last year.  He brings new perspective, diverse talents and tremendous expertise to his role as a member of our strategic and executive teams.  I look forward to his continued involvement as we transform our business for the future."
 
"Over the past year I’ve seen firsthand Wal-Mart’s transformation on sustainability and health care and its record on economic opportunity and job creation.  The changes are real and substantial steps for the business," said Dach.  "I look forward to working with Wal-Mart and its senior management to continue on its path of change."
 
Prior to joining Wal-Mart, Dach was Vice Chairman of Edelman, one of the world’s largest global public relations and strategic communications firms. In that capacity, he managed the company’s Washington office, its global public affairs, crisis and technology practices, and its research and advertising companies. For the last year, he has led Edelman’s team supporting Wal-Mart’s corporate affairs operations.
 
Dach has worked for the U.S. Senate, major non-governmental organizations such as the National Audubon Society and Environmental Defense, and has extensive campaign experience.  He serves on the Board of Directors of the National Audubon Society and the World Resources Institute.
 
About Wal-Mart
Wal-Mart Stores, Inc. operates Wal-Mart discount stores, supercenters, Neighborhood Markets and SAM’S CLUB locations in the United States. The company has operations in Argentina, Brazil, Canada, China, Costa Rica, El Salvador, Germany, Guatemala, Honduras, Japan, Mexico, Nicaragua, Puerto Rico, South Korea and the United Kingdom. The company’s securities are listed on the New York Stock Exchange and NYSE Arca, formerly the Pacific Stock Exchange, under the symbol WMT.
